Safari on Mac - Two Page Display

Hi, I have a problem with viewing pdfs inline in Safari (v 18.6) on my Mac (macOS 15.6.1). The thing is, when I switch to "Two Pages" viewing mode, it doesn't display the first page as a single page, as it should. This breaks the layout for images spanning over two pages.


Preview and Acrobat do this right (example screenshots attached). Is there a way to create the pdf (in my case, from Apple Pages) somehow differently, so that it always shows a single page first in both Safari and Preview?
